Transaction cd91e282fec13a76144b66155450b0fb7a2cc0e50c9e0edc336478588e4722da
3 Input
2 Outputs
- cd91e282fec13a76144b66155450b0fb7a2cc0e50c9e0edc336478588e4722da:0
- cd91e282fec13a76144b66155450b0fb7a2cc0e50c9e0edc336478588e4722da:1
value 1327673
address 1DvAhNTKH9QNWRfL9YG46xMp3eLvbUbeUB
value 95252615
address 3AKwBeGxtnXSRumBa8SSyKtiTEXdrPyLXW